Danny Sabatello, a name familiar to mixed martial arts (MMA) enthusiasts due to his colorful personality and competitive spirit, is set to make waves in a new organization—Rizin Fighting Federation (FF). The former interim Bellator title contender and PFL athlete recently secured a three-fight contract with the Japan-based promotion. For MMA fans, this development marks a significant shift in the landscape of combat sports, potentially revitalizing Sabatello’s career while introducing a unique American flair to the often traditional Japanese MMA scene.

Having faced challenges in finding regular competition post-PFL’s acquisition of Bellator, Sabatello sees his move as an opportunity to rejuvenate his fighting career. He has openly praised Rizin for its effective communication and well-structured negotiation process, contrasting this with his previous experiences. Sabatello views this transition as not just a career move but a potential game changer, both for him and for American fighters aspiring to make their mark in Asia.

Known for his bold character and unabashed self-promotion, Sabatello embraces the polarizing nature of his persona as he prepares for his Rizin debut. He firmly believes that his distinct attitude will resonate with the Japanese audience—drawing in both supporters and critics alike. “I think I’m going to be massive over there,” Sabatello remarked, highlighting his expectation that his loud, brash style will either attract a fan base or spark polarizing reactions. It’s this very duality that he thrives on; he understands the importance of being memorable in an industry rife with competition.

Sabatello’s recent comments indicate a strategic mindset regarding his career trajectory. He acknowledges that not many American fighters venture into Rizin, which positions him as a pioneer of sorts. His inherent belief in leading the charge could open doors not only for himself but also for fellow fighters who may want to follow suit. “After me signing with Rizin, I actually think that a bunch of other fighters are going to try to get in there…” he speculated, showcasing his confidence that success could inspire others.

By embracing an unorthodox path, Sabatello aims to spark a cultural shift within MMA, encouraging Western fighters to explore opportunities beyond established organizations like the UFC. This could signify a collaborative evolution in MMA, where fighters are encouraged to seek diverse platforms and experiences rather than strictly adhering to the traditional American fight circuit.

While Sabatello’s motivations seem to extend beyond monetary compensation, financial savvy remains a crucial element of his negotiations. He emphasizes fairness, highlighting his intent to ensure he receives what he deserves relative to his expertise and marketability. “This isn’t about money, but I will never be taken advantage of,” he stated, suggesting a balanced approach to career advancement.

Though he refrains from placing overt emphasis on financial gain, Sabatello’s business acumen is evident. He recognizes his negotiating power and intends to leverage it effectively. This calculated approach contrasts with the impulsive decisions often seen in the sport and could serve as a lesson for younger fighters about the value of self-worth and career planning.
